CVD Equipment Corporation announced it had appointed Dr. Ashraf Lotfi to its Board of Directors. The Board of Directors also approved an expansion of the number of directors from the current level of five to six. Dr. Lotfi is currently a venture partner with Deep Sciences Ventures and serves on the board of Lotus Microsystems, ApS.

Dr. Lotfi previously served as Vice President and a Fellow at Intel Corporation. Prior to Intel, he was Power Chief Technology Officer for Altera Corporation serving its Enpirion Power Business as well as the broader Field Programmable Gate Array community. Altera was acquired by Intel in 2015.

Prior to Altera, he served as President and Chief Executive Officer of Enpirion Inc., which he founded in 2002. From Enpirion?s inception, Dr. Lotfi led its strategic direction with a unique industry-first vision to create the ultimate power converter-on-chip creating ubiquitous DC-DC conversion at the silicon level. In 2013, he led Enpirion?s merger into Altera to realize his vision of highly integrated power management closely coupled to digital silicon loads.

Prior to founding Enpirion, he was Director of Advanced Power Research at Bell Laboratories.
